This past Sunday, I had the honor of participating in a Harry Potter birthday celebration at the Caramel Crisp Corner in Oshkosh, Wisconsin. For those of you who don’t know, this fine establishment is a combination bakery, café serving coffee drinks and ice cream, gift shop, and bookstore – i.e. a few of my favorite things manifested under one roof – all in one convenient location. I would highly recommend the Caramel Crisp Corner to anyone passing through Oshkosh. For those with an interest in aircraft, the annual EAA AirVenture event also wrapped up while I was in the city.

The event was so much fun! There were owls and snakes! Build-your-own-bookmarks with Elle Binder! And butterbeer – yum! I met and visited with quite a few excellent human beings, families with children, cosplay enthusiasts, and young people who love fantasy. I sold more copies of Wyldling Snare than I anticipated, which was icing on an already fantastic cake.

Steal the Morrow by Jenelle Schmidt

http://mybook.to/stealthemorrow

The city may be dangerous, but it holds his only hope…

Abandoned on a remote highway after bandits murder his parents, young Olifur finds safety with Fritjof. The gruff woodsman teaches him and other orphans to live off the land. When Fritjof falls ill, Olifur will risk everything to save his mentor—even travel to far-off Melar seeking a doctor.

However, the city of Melar is more perilous than Olifur imagined, and doctors aren’t cheap. His quest leads him first to a hazardous job working on the elevated trains high above the city. But the dangers in the clouds are nothing compared to those on the ground. Olifur soon finds himself ensnared in a web of professional thieves, and he must think fast if he is to survive the day and bring the much-needed aid to Fritjof before it is too late.

Schmidt reweaves Charles Dickens’ “Oliver Twist” into an exciting tale of integrity and perseverance in this gaslamp-fantasy adventure.
